Are you looking for a rewarding career, tight-knit nursing team and top-notch benefits?
Work location: Texas Health Alliance, 10864 Texas Health Trail, Fort Worth, TX 76244
Work hours: Part-time nights, 24 hours weekly, 2-12 hours shifts, 7:00 pm - 7:00 am
Mother/Baby Unit Department highlights:
- Texas Health Alliance is a Baby-friendly and Texas 10-step designated facility.
- 40-bed Postpartum/Newborn, couplet care
- Average between 160 to170 deliveries per month and increasing volume
- 12-bed NICU/Neonatal ICU
- 4 OB/ED bays
- 14-bed LDR's
- 2 OR suites
Texas Health Alliance is a 151-bed, full-service hospital serving our community since 2012. Our location in North Fort Worth provides convenient care to people in North Fort Worth, Keller, North Richland Hills, Haslet, Roanoke and surrounding areas.
We're Joint Commission-accredited with a Level III neonatal intensive care unit. Plus, we're a Baby Friendly Facility and Pathways to Excellence designated hospital. We are also a Joint Commission Acute Heart Attack Ready (AHAR) Disease specific certified. We provide wellness services, outpatient surgery and women's imaging services and are a top choice in North Fort Worth for radiology services and much more.
Here's What You Need
• Associate Degree in Nursing or Diploma in Nursing required; BSN preferred
• RN - Registered Nurse Upon Hire required
• BCLS - Basic Cardiac Life Support prior to providing independent patient care and maintained quarterly required
• NRP - Essential Neonatal Resuscitation Program within 90 Days of hire
• NRPA-Advanced Neonatal Resuscitation Program within 90 Days of hire
• CPI - Crisis Prevention Intervention Training Maintained Annually within 90 Days of hire
• 1 Year Experience as a clinical nurse or completion of an RN residency program Req
• 1 year of Mother Baby/Antepartum experience strongly preferred
What You Will Do
Delivers care to patients utilizing the Nursing Process
• Assesses the patient
• Plans the care of the patient
• Intervenes as appropriate
• Evaluates the effectiveness of interventions
• Incorporates age specific safety/infection control measures into patient care.
• Initiates action to meet patient and/or significant others need for information
• Maintains continuity of patient care inter-shift, inter-hospital, and while expediting out of hospital transfers.
Additional perks of being a Texas Health employee
- Benefits include 401k, PTO, medical, dental, Paid Parental Leave, flex spending, tuition reimbursement, Student Loan Repayment Program as well as several other benefits.
- Delivery of high quality of patient care through nursing education, nursing research and innovations in nursing practice.
- Strong Unit Based Council (UBC).
- A supportive, team environment with outstanding opportunities for growth.
